94 3000gt. i have the radio code, but it just says off cause my stupid brother thought it would be a good idea to just guess. so now it just says off. I unhooked the battery overnight, but it still says off, does anyone know how to get the codE screen back?

NO

i think you have to leave the key in the on position for like an hour

correct! put the key in the ignition, turn it to the ON position (but don't start your car), and leave it there for an hour. ohh, and make sure not to lock your keys in the car :loser: , that's what i did!

this is how you reset your radio so that you can enter the security code. this is what the guy at the dealership told me to do, and after doing this it worked.

good luck.

you can turn the car on....its just a matter of time...doesn't have to be all at once...just have to drive around for an hour total, until it says code again.
